we faced a problem in power plant consisted of 4 diesel generators 400 v synchronise togather and every generator connected to 400v/11kv delta/wye Transformer the synchronisation in low voltage side (400v) when we turn on the first generator it's transformer rise up the voltage to 11kv and this voltage delivered to all transformers in the high voltage side (11kv) but in each low voltage sides of each transformer there's only two phases live and the other one have 0 voltage ( we tested by voltmeter ) we tried by starting from other generator but it's the same problem. all the for transformers act like that (when we feed it from low voltage side it work perfectly but when we feed it from high voltage side there's missing phase in the other side (400)!! ... could u help me plzzz ???

First of all, touching with your bare hands is liable to make you dead, not just sick!!

As David said, measuring from phase to ground without the generators running is not meaningful. The generators provide the only ground source, so when they are not running, there is no defined voltage from phase to ground. Measure the phase-to-phase voltages.
 
It's possible that one phase of your generators are intentionally grounded, although that would be unusual.

As others have said, you you measured phase to phase with a volt meter? (not your fingers!)

I would be checking the connections on the synchroscope.
It is possible that someone used 240:120 PTs, phase to ground for the synchroscope rather than 400:120 PTs phase to phase.
That would probably give the symptoms as I understand them on an ungrounded delta system.

actually the terberg "synch. module" phase voltages was L1=0,L2=680,L3=400 but i measured it by voltmeter: L1L2=400,L2L3=400,L1L3=400 .... and according to ground
L1=0,L2=400,L3=400 !!! does any one tell me y this transformer act like that ??!!
 
One phase has a connection to ground in each transformer. Probably a PT for the synchroscope connected to ground.
Other than that, look for some device that each transformer LV side has that is connected to ground in each instance.
